THIS IS A SYNOPSIS AS REQUIRED BY FAR PART 5.2 – IT DOES NOT CONSTITUTE A RE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L, REQUEST FOR QUOTE, OR INVITATION FOR BID.
The intent of this notice is to notify potential offerors that Lajes Field, Terceira, Azores, Portugal intends to solicit proposals and award a single award firm fixed price contract using FAR Parts 12, 13, 37, with FAR Part 15 evaluation procedures. The contract term will be a base period of eleven (12) months plus four (4) one (1) year options, beginning on 1 December 2025 to 30 November 2030.
This synopsis is for a solicitation for the following: Non-Personal Service: The Contractor shall provide all management, tools, equipment, and labor necessary to ensure that custodial services are performed at Lajes Field, in a manner that will maintain a satisfactory facility condition and present a clean, neat and professional appearance. The contractor shall accomplish all cleaning tasks and be required to provide and replenish soap and paper products in all restrooms identified in Appendices A and B, to meet the requirements of Performance Work Statement (PWS). Minimum cleaning frequencies are established in Appendix A, Air Force Custodial Common Levels of Service Standards. Facility cleaning levels and estimated square footages are established in Appendix B, Estimated Square Footages and Cleaning Level.
All work performed by the contractor shall be performed in accordance with all applicable laws, regulations, final governing standards for Portugal, instructions, and commercial practices.
The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) assigned to this acquisition is 561720 - Janitorial Services. The contemplated contract is to be performed in Azores, Portugal.
Tentative date for issuance of Solicitation FA448625R0001 is 01 August 2025. The closing date, time for submission of offers, as well as the date and time for pre-proposal conference will be contained in the solicitation package.
Solicitation documents will be posted on the Government Point of Entry located at https://www.sam.gov and in the local chamber of commerce in Angra do Heroísmo. Potential offerors are responsible for monitoring this site for the release of the solicitation package and any other pertinent information and for downloading their own copy of the solicitation package.
Potential offerors MUST be registered in the System for Award Management to be eligible for award (See internet site: https://www.sam.gov) or their proposal will not be considered. Payment for this acquisition will be made electronically through the Wide Area Workflow (WAWF) System via the Procurement Integrated Enterprise Environment (PIEE).
The point of contact for this procurement are the Contract Specialist Ms. Tania Cardoso, tania.cardoso.2.pt@us.af.mil and the Contracting Officer Ms. Claudia Silva, claudia.silva.pt@us.af.mil.
This announcement serves as the Advance Notice for this project.
Responses to the synopsis are not required.
